#2db909 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2db909 is composed of 17.6% red, 72.5%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 95.1% yellow and 27.5% black. It has a hue angle of 107.7 degrees, a saturation of 90.7% and a lightness of 38%. #2db909 color hex could be obtained by blending #5aff12 with #007300.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

#2db909 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2db909 has RGB values of R:45, G:185,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0, Y:0.95,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 2996489.
